Some historical information on the meeting between FC Rouen 1899 and Concarneau, ahead of this Friday’s showdown at the Stade Robert-Diochon.
The record between the two teams is perfectly balanced, with 1 win, 1 draw and 1 defeat.
The last home win over Concarnois dates back to 2006, when our Rouennais won 4-0 thanks to goals from Mathieu Duhamel X2, Stéphane Lalaoui and Mourad Jalliti.
Many of them have played for both clubs in the first team : Malik Abdelmoula, Zana Allée, Vidian Valérius and Alexandre Vincent.
